用python写一个抓取折线图数据的例子
时间: 2023-03-13 15:04:52 浏览: 53
这取决于您想抓取的折线图数据类型。假设您想抓取从网站上获取的折线图数据,那么可以使用Python中的urllib库来实现:import urllib
url = 'http://example.com/graphdata.csv'
data = urllib.request.urlopen(url).read()然后,可以使用Python中的csv库来解析折线图数据,以便进行进一步处理:import csv
data = csv.reader(data)
for row in data:
# Do something with row
pass
相关问题
用python写一个书籍数据的折线图
好的,我们可以使用Python中的Pandas和Matplotlib库来创建一个书籍数据的折线图。
首先,我们需要准备一些书籍数据。假设我们有一个包含每月销售量的CSV文件,它包含三列:日期、书名和销售量。以下是一个示例数据:
```
日期,书名,销售量
2021-01,Python入门,100
2021-01,数据分析,80
2021-02,Python入门,120
2021-02,数据分析,90
2021-03,Python入门,150
2021-03,数据分析,110
```
接下来,我们可以使用Pandas库来读取CSV文件并将数据转换为DataFrame对象。然后,我们可以使用Matplotlib来创建折线图。以下是完整的代码:
```python
import pandas as pd
import matplotlib.pyplot as plt
# 读取CSV文件
df = pd.read_csv('book_sales.csv')
# 按书名分组
groups = df.groupby('书名')
# 创建折线图
fig, ax = plt.subplots()
for name, group in groups:
ax.plot(group['日期'], group['销售量'], label=name)
# 添加标题和标签
ax.set_title('书籍销售量')
ax.set_xlabel('日期')
ax.set_ylabel('销售量')
# 添加图例
ax.legend()
# 显示图形
plt.show()
```
在上面的代码中,我们首先使用Pandas库读取CSV文件,并将数据转换为DataFrame对象。然后,我们按书名分组,并使用Matplotlib创建折线图。最后,我们添加了标题、标签和图例,并使用show函数显示图形。
运行代码后,您将看到一个包含两条折线的图表,每条折线代表一本书的销售量。
用python写一个折线图
以下是使用Python Matplotlib库编写折线图的示例代码:
```python
import matplotlib.pyplot as plt
# 数据
x = [1, 2, 3, 4, 5]
y = [2, 4, 6, 8, 10]
# 创建图形和坐标轴
fig, ax = plt.subplots()
# 画折线图
ax.plot(x, y)
# 设置标题和标签
ax.set_title('Line Chart')
ax.set_xlabel('X Axis')
ax.set_ylabel('Y Axis')
# 显示图形
plt.show()
```
运行代码后,将会显示一个简单的折线图。您可以根据自己的需要更改数据、标题、标签和其他样式选项来创建自定义的折线图。